At today’s technology conference, OPPO has released three technologies to the VOOC flash charger family: SuperVOOC 2.0 with a maximum charging power of 65W, wireless VOOC flash charging with a maximum charging power of 30W and VOOC 4.0.

First look at the fastest commercial speed of SuperVOOC 2.0, OPPO has recently confirmed, Reno Ace released on the 10th next month will launch this charging technology. Compared to the SuperVOOC with a 35-minute battery filled with 3400mAh, the charging speed of SuperVOOC 2.0 is accelerated again. OPPO has been spoiled by the fact that it can be filled with Reno Ace for 30 minutes, while Reno Ace’s battery capacity is expected to be around 4000mAh.

SuperVOOC 2.0 still uses the previous generation dual-cell SuperVOOC direct charging architecture. This time, the charging voltage is still 10V, and the current is increased from the previous generation 5A to 6.5A. The dual-cell series structure makes each battery charge 5V. It is still the low voltage, high current and fast charge of VOOC flash charging.

The difference is that this time, SuperVOOC 2.0 is equipped with a new semiconductor material – GaN (gallium nitride), which improves the charging efficiency, reduces heat generation, and effectively shortens the charging time. Reduce the size of the adapter. The cell and interface technology on the mobile phone side has been further improved to help improve charging efficiency and reduce heat generation during charging.

OPPO made a big killer for the first time to do wireless charging: 30W wireless VOOC flash charging, this power is flush with the wireless charging technology released by Xiaomi recently.

OPPO says that under this charging technology, the equivalent 4000mAh battery energy can be charged to 100% in 80 minutes. This charging efficiency is almost the same as OPPO’s own existing VOOC flash charging speed. And it is also compatible with the Qi standard, supporting 5W, 10W two-speed charging power.

The last release was VOOC 4.0 technology. Since 2014, VOOC flash charging technology has been evolving. This time VOOC 4.0 has a higher charging power: 30W. It can charge the 4000mAh battery to 67% in 30 minutes and 100% in 73 minutes, which is 12% shorter than the previous generation technology.

At the same time, it is also backward compatible with the previous VOOC flash charging protocol, which can get 5V4A (20W) full-load charging power. Similar to SuperVOOC 2.0 in Reno Ace next month, VOOC 4.0 will also be launched next month.On the K5 mid-range machine.
